In Social Studies over the past two weeks we have been discussing all that we think we know about our community helper nurses and questions that we had. We surprisingly knew a lot about nurses and some of our parents are even nurses! Then we shared out all of the questions we wanted to learn about nurses and boy we sure did have a lot! We wanted to know what kind of clothes they where, the tools they use, and what type of places that they work? We then used one of our favorite resources PebbleGo to do some research on these wonderful community helpers and we learned A LOT! We learned that they take care of patients (people who go to the doctors for help with their health), that they work in homes, hospitals, and clinics, and that they wear scrubs, masks, and gloves! We just loved learning all about nurses! We even were able to draw and label our very own nurse! Thank you for all that you do!
